1. Importance of Pre-Treatment Preparation
Prior to undergoing root canal treatment, patients must engage in thorough pre-treatment preparations to safeguard their health and optimize the outcome. Its essential to have an honest discussion with your dentist about your medical history, current medications, and any allergies. This information helps dental professionals identify potential complications that could arise during treatment.
Additionally, ensuring you are well-informed about the procedure is essential. Patients should seek resources or ask their dentist about what to expect during the treatment, including recovery times and aftercare protocols. Knowing these factors can alleviate anxiety, making the process smoother.
Lastly, consider scheduling your treatment at a time when you can allow for rest afterward. Root canal procedures may require both time and energy for recovery, so avoid busy days that could add stress to your experience. Preparation is key to a successful outcome.
2. Understanding the Root Canal Procedure
Understanding each step of the root canal procedure can greatly reduce apprehension and foster a sense of control during the treatment. The initial step typically involves the dentist taking X-rays to assess the tooths condition and plan the course of action. Ensuring that the dentist discusses these findings and explains how they will affect your treatment can provide peace of mind.
During the procedure, patients can expect to receive a local anesthetic, which minimizes discomfort. Its important to communicate any sensations you feel during the treatment, as this will help the dentist make necessary adjustments to ensure your comfort.
Lastly, its vital to recognize the importance of thorough cleaning and disinfection of the root canals. Post-treatment instructions from your dentist will guide you on proper oral hygiene practices. Understanding these procedures and what they entail can contribute significantly to your comfort and effectiveness of treatment.
3. Choosing a Qualified Dental Practitioner
Choosing the right dental professional is paramount for ensuring the safety and effectiveness of your root canal treatment. Begin by looking for practitioners with specific training and experience in endodontics. Research their credentials and ask about their experience performing root canals to gauge their expertise.
Read reviews and ask for recommendations from friends or family members who have undergone similar treatments. Direct feedback from patients can provide insights into both the dentists technical skills and their interpersonal approach, which is just as crucial to a positive experience.
Finally, consider visiting the dental office before your appointment. This allows you to assess the environment and gauge how comfortable you feel. A clean, welcoming atmosphere can significantly enhance your overall experience during such a procedure.
4. Post-Treatment Care and Follow-Up
Post-treatment care is critical in ensuring the long-term success of the root canal procedure. After the treatment, patients should follow the specific aftercare instructions provided by their dentist carefully. This may include taking prescribed pain relievers and avoiding certain foods for a while.
Monitoring the healing process is equally important. Be aware of any persistent pain or complications post-treatment, and do not hesitate to reach out to your dentist if something feels amiss. Early intervention can prevent larger issues from developing.
Lastly, regular follow-up appointments are necessary to ensure proper healing and assess the condition of the treated tooth. These visits allow dentists to monitor the tooths health and intervene if additional treatment is necessary.
